Suicidal subject in downtown Columbia

(COLUMBIA, MO) -

Columbia Police officers responded to downtown Columbia today at 11:10 a.m. in reference to a reported suicidal subject with a gun. Boone County Joint Communications received information from a complainant that a friend was threatening suicide and had access to a gun.

The initial information indicated the female subject was traveling in a vehicle in the 300 block of Hitt Street. She abandoned her vehicle near Hitt Street and Elm Street and proceeded on foot. Officers confirmed the female was on the University of Missouri campus and still continuously moving on foot. Columbia Police officers, including Patrol officers, K-9 Unit officers, detectives with the Street Crimes Unit, Community Outreach Unit officers, and officers from the Crisis Negotiation Team, along with University of Missouri Police officers actively searched the area in efforts of locating her. At 12:51 p.m., Columbia Police officers located the female in the 400 block of Park Avenue where she was taken into custody. She was not in possession of a firearm at the time of being detained and was transported to a local hospital for evaluation.        

At approximately 1:22 p.m., officers located a firearm in the 1000 block of University Avenue; it is believed the female was in possession of the firearm and had discarded it at that location.

At no time throughout this investigation was there any indication that the female had any intentions on harming anyone else.
